# #194331

A color — dark, luxury, bold. Deterministic analysis from BrandSweets (no inference).

## Values

- Hex: `#194331`
- RGB: rgb(25, 67, 49)
- HSL: hsl(154, 46%, 18%)
- OKLCH: oklch(0.347 0.057 162.8)
- Relative luminance: 0.0444

##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 11.12: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A pass
- On black (#000000): 1.89:1 — AA fail, AA-large fail,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#328661 (4.72:1); AA: background → #a6a6a6 (4.57:1); AAA: text → #3ea87a (7.09:1); AAA: background → #cfcfcf (7.14:1)
